Types of Vehicles:

Istria offers a diverse range of landscapes, from coastal roads to winding mountain paths. To make the most of your journey, choose a vehicle that suits your travel itinerary. Compact cars like the Fiat 500 or Volkswagen Polo are perfect for exploring urban areas and narrow streets, while SUVs or crossovers like the Nissan Qashqai or Ford Kuga offer added comfort and versatility for those venturing into the countryside.


Booking in Advance:

To secure the best rates and ensure availability, it's advisable to book your rental car in advance. Online platforms and comparison websites like Expedia, Rentalcars.com, and Kayak make it easy to compare prices and amenities, helping you make an informed decision. Keep in mind that peak tourist seasons, typically in summer, may see increased demand, so booking ahead is especially important during these times.


Insurance and Additional Services:

Before finalizing your rental, it's crucial to understand the insurance options available. Basic coverage is usually included in the rental price, but you may want to consider additional coverage for added peace of mind. This could include collision damage waiver (CDW), theft protection, and personal accident insurance. Additionally, consider services like GPS navigation, child seats, and roadside assistance for a worry-free journey.
